    My favorite item has to be my scanner. I used to own a Canon 8800F flatbed scanner. While I loved the scanner, it took quite a long time to scan many pictures when I was given a job that involved scanning said images. So not long ago, I purchased the Kodak Picture Saver PS50. It can scan 50 pictures a minute at 300 DPI. At the time of purchase, it came with a free flatbed attachment. It is pricey, but well worth the investment.
